Top 5 Horror Games on Android in Australia Q4 2021

During the fourth quarter of 2021, the top 5 horror games on the Android platform in Australia exhibited diverse trends in downloads, revenue, and active users. Here's a closer look at their performance:

Identity V from NetEase Games saw an overall stable performance. Weekly revenue fluctuated, peaking at $2.9K in the week of September 27 and ending the quarter with $2.8K in the final week of December. Downloads gradually increased from 41 to 63 per week, while active users ranged between 1.8K and 2K throughout the period.

Hello Neighbor by tinyBuild experienced a notable rise in weekly downloads, starting at 929 and climbing to 1.4K by the end of December. Revenue also saw a significant jump, reaching $425 in the last week of December. Active users showed an increasing trend, moving from 6.5K to 7.7K over the quarter.

Five Nights at Freddy's AR from Illumix Inc. had a remarkable spike in weekly downloads, particularly in December, where they surged to 1.4K. Revenue saw a peak of $832 in the week of December 20, while active users increased from 10.2K to 15.8K by the end of the quarter.

Five Nights at Freddy's by Clickteam USA LLC showcased a significant boost in both downloads and revenue towards the end of the quarter. Downloads increased from 75 to 371, and revenue reached $548 in the final week of December. Active users saw a sharp rise, growing from 368 to 1.2K over the quarter.

Very Little Nightmares by BANDAI NAMCO Entertainment Europe had a steady but modest performance. Downloads varied slightly, peaking at 25 in the last week of December. Revenue fluctuated throughout the quarter, reaching $157 in the week of October 4.

These insights, derived from data provided by Sensor Tower, highlight the varied performance of horror games on the Android platform in Australia during Q4 2021. For more detailed insights, visit Sensor Tower.
